Transaction e68956ffc261071ab71cd1a67d49c6d1d4081c1499ca10617c3e00d0136a236e
1 Input
1 Output
-
e68956ffc261071ab71cd1a67d49c6d1d4081c1499ca10617c3e00d0136a236e:0
- value
- 47581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1eb22df8c29fad3bec0d9f7d8547e6447725f4b OP_EQUAL
- address
- 3LpxqBq9DEV1bkLoyi7FKS2cFNYpkXshsQ